   Hridayaragam

           Since 2004, Madras Medical Mission and Malayala Manorama have been joining hands to offer free cardiac surgery to children below poverty line from Kerala under the Hridayapoorvam Sakhyam programme. The first 100 of these children were supported by Malayala Manorama. The next 100 was to be treated by resources raised by Madras Medical Mission. World Malayalee Council led by noted Chennai businessmen Mr. Reji Abraham, Mr. N.R.Panicker and Mr. A.V.Anoop graciously came forward to offer assistance to these children. Under their dynamic leadership a musical night "Hridaya Raagam" was organized on 25.02.06 at the Wesley school grounds at Royapettah, Chennai. The programme was inaugurated by Padmashri
K.J.Yesudas. Led by Shri. M.Jayachandran, noted composer and playback singer, a large number of cine artistes and playback singers rendered enthralling performance to support the cause of cardiac surgery for poor children.

         From the funds raised, World Malayalee Council supported 25 children under the Hridayapoorvam Sakhyam project. Noting the overwhelming requests for surgeries, WMC enhanced the number of beneficiaries under this scheme to 60, 58 of whom have already been operated. Just like the 200 children under Hridayapoorvam Sakhyam programme, all the children under the Hridaya Raagam programme have also undergone successful surgery and have been restored to normal life.
 
Hridayaragam 2008

           The Madras Medical Mission, World Malayalee Council and Malayalam Manorama once again extended hands to support cardiac surgery for under privileged children. The Musicians from the South Indian Film Industry performed the programme at the Nehru Indoor Stadium Chennai, on 24 th February 2008, to raise funds for cardiac surgery for nearly 100 children from the lower socio economic groups both from Kerala and Tamil Nadu.

           Padmashree Dr. Kamal Hassan was the Project Ambassador of this event.
